Output ad59b642576769d1f4300641224f6e594d3847498cf7c24eb8aca025425f2a25:23

value
17200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d970ecb0da6583aae83dffe0cdd1abfca69e3b5 OP_EQUAL
address
34PUUnXgLM5mE3vV8T2hD8Si6w97Vyp7zh
transaction
ad59b642576769d1f4300641224f6e594d3847498cf7c24eb8aca025425f2a25
spent
true